Pricing changes are inevitable in any SaaS business, but how you communicate these changes can significantly influence customer satisfaction and retention. Here’s how to effectively manage pricing communication:
Importance of Clear Communication
Maintaining Trust: Transparent communication reinforces customer trust and brand integrity.
Managing Expectations: Clearly explaining pricing changes helps customers understand the reasons and minimizes negative reactions.
Steps for Effective Communication
Prepare Messaging: Clearly outline reasons for the pricing changes (e.g., feature improvements, increased costs).
Advance Notice: Provide customers with ample notice, allowing them time to adapt to new pricing.
Multiple Channels: Use various communication channels (email, notifications, customer portals) to ensure customers receive the message.
Managing Customer Reactions
Customer Support: Equip customer support teams with comprehensive information and talking points.
Flexible Options: Offer alternative options or grandfathering of existing terms to long-standing customers when possible.
Best Practices
Transparency and Clarity: Be honest and direct about why pricing changes are necessary.
Highlight Value: Clearly articulate additional value customers will receive from the pricing adjustments.
Feedback Loops: Encourage and address customer feedback proactively.
Practical Tip: Regularly communicate ongoing value enhancements alongside pricing adjustments to reinforce your product’s worth and maintain customer goodwill.
